Heba Elhanafy

Chief of Staff & Researcher

[email protected]

Heba is an accomplished urban planner, and researcher, holding a bachelor’s degree in Architecture and Urban Planning from Alexandria University and a master’s degree in Urban Development from the Technical University of Berlin. She has collaborated on numerous urban development and research projects with both regional and international organizations, including UN-Habitat, UNHCR, Ecumene Studio, and the Charter Cities Institute.

Her research interests are centered on human settlements, culture, new cities, community, and urban development, with a particular emphasis on African cities. This focus has enabled her to conduct extensive work and research across the continent, including in Cairo, Tunis, Lusaka, Nairobi, Dar es Salaam, and Zanzibar. Follow her on Twitter @hebaelhanafi
